Output a23339e602cd8fcbf5ba07b24ace4bdc5c49971b951b184cdcc75b3c6a4b31b2:3

value
745442176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f3b11da9baa87e75c448862c8f74b0e5913d08 OP_EQUAL
address
354QBTT4tF5gmEs8QSJESd2zimVWU4fjeh
transaction
a23339e602cd8fcbf5ba07b24ace4bdc5c49971b951b184cdcc75b3c6a4b31b2
spent
true